But here's what actually determines how your body heals, performs, and feels: Your nervous system.
Your nervous system controls:
🔹 Inflammation response
🔹 Pain perception
🔹 Sleep quality and energy levels
🔹 Stress resilience
🔹 Immune function
🔹 Recovery speed
When your nervous system is stuck in "fight or flight" mode (sympathetic dominance), your body can't properly recover, no matter how much you rest.
Signs your nervous system needs support:
❌ Difficulty sleeping or staying asleep
❌ Constant tension or inability to relax
❌ Heightened pain sensitivity
❌ Anxiety or racing thoughts
❌ Poor recovery despite adequate rest

PEMF therapy supports nervous system regulation by:
✔️ Promoting parasympathetic activation (rest and digest mode)
✔️ Reducing stress-related inflammation
✔️ Supporting healthy brain wave patterns
✔️ Enhancing vagal nerve function

The result: Your body shifts from survival mode to recovery mode, where true healing happens.

Fascia is a connective tissue that supports and protects the body's structures by providing a supportive, fibrous network for muscles, organs, nerves and joints. Its key functions include stabilizing body structures, enabling smooth movement by reducing friction, protecting delicate tissues, transmitting force, and assisting with venous return.
Fascia transmits force generated by muscles through the body, which is essential for movement.
Structures like the plantar fascia provide dynamic support to the foot's arch, especially during activities like walking.
The deep fascia in the lower limbs helps increase venous return, pushing blood back up towards the heart.
🗣️Fascia plays a role in regulating the efficacy of the lymphatic system. The lymphatic system has no pump and is critical for overall health and wellbeing💯
Fascia is rich in sensory nerves, including mechanoreceptors, which provide your brain with information about your body's position in space (proprioception).
It also contains nociceptors (pain receptors) and thermoreceptors, contributing to pain and temperature sensation.
